Understanding Publisher Agreements

Publisher agreements are crucial legal documents in the publishing industry. They outline the relationship and responsibilities between authors and publishers, defining how works are published and rights are managed.
  • A publisher agreement is a contract that details the terms under which an author’s work is published. It serves to protect the rights of both parties and clarifies the expectations.
  • The primary parties in a publisher agreement are the author, who creates the work, and the publisher, who facilitates its distribution. Both roles are pivotal for a successful publication.
  • The agreement lays the groundwork for how intellectual property is handled, including royalties, rights management, and distribution, thus safeguarding the interests of both authors and publishers.

Reviewing the Terms of Your Publisher Agreement

Thoroughly reviewing the terms of your publisher agreement is essential for avoiding future disputes.
  • Consulting with a legal expert ensures that all terms are fair and comply with publishing standards.
  • Be wary of vague terms, which can lead to misunderstandings; also, look out for unfavorable royalty clauses.
  • Clearly decipher how royalties are calculated and paid out to avoid future discrepancies.

Navigating Rights in Publishing Agreements

Understanding the rights outlined in your publishing agreement is crucial.
  • Exclusive rights grant the publisher complete control over distribution, while non-exclusive rights allow authors to engage with multiple publishers.
  • These rights pertain to various forms of media beyond the initial publication, like adaptations for film or international editions.
  • Defining where and when a work will be published can greatly impact its marketability and availability.

Handling Disputes and Modifications in Agreements

Disputes may arise in any contractual relationship; knowing how to handle these is vital.
  • Issues often stem from misunderstandings of royalty calculations, rights management, or fulfillment of obligations.
  • Modifications should be drafted with clear agreement from both parties, ideally in writing, to avoid future conflict.
